>[!TIP]
>When creating a type A record pay attention to the value of the `TTL` field:
>When creating a type A DNS record pay attention to the value of the `TTL` field:
>it tracks the number of seconds DNS clients and DNS resolvers are allowed to
>cache the resolved IP address for the record.
>You may want to keep the TTL low (min is 60 secs) if you plan to use the record
>cache the resolved IP address.
>You may want to keep the TTL low (the allowed minimum is 60 secs) if you plan to use the record
>to track the (dynamic) IP address of a host in a DDNS scenario.

Quickstart Library
====
The ddflare go library allows updates of DNS type A records with the actual Public IP address in 4 steps:
1. create a new _DNSManager_ (`NewDNSManager()`)
2. initialize the DNSManager with the authentication credentials (`.Init()`)
3. retrieve the current public IP address (`GetPublicIP()`)
4. update the DNS record via the DNSManager (`.UpdateFQDN`)


**Example**:
```go
import "github.com/fgiudici/ddflare"

func main() {
// fqdn to be updated
fqdn := "www.myddns.host"
// auth Token from the DDNS service if available or contatenation of user:password
authToken := "user:password"

// create a new DNSManager targeting the desired service (ddflare.Cloudflare,
// ddflare.NoIP or ddflare.DDNS). For a DDNS provider using the DynDNS API v3
// but not in the list, pick ddflare.DDNS and set a custom API endpoint with
// dm.SetAPIEndpoint("$HTTP_ENDPOINT")
dm, err := ddflare.NewDNSManager(ddflare.NoIP)
if err != nil {
log.Fatal(err)
}

// init the DNSManager with the API credentials
if err = dm.Init(authToken); err != nil {
log.Fatal(err)
}

// retrieve the current Public IP address
pubIP, err := ddflare.GetPublicIP()
if err != nil {
log.Fatal(err)
}
// set the Public IP address just retrieved as the addres of `fqdn`
if err = dm.UpdateFQDN(fqdn, pubIP); err != nil {
log.Fatal("update failed")
}

log.Info("update successful")
}
```
